About the Course
This course is a part of the "Foster Parent Training: An In-Depth Exploration of Advanced Topics. Trainings will provide in-depth discussion of topics relevant for providing developmentally appropriate, trauma-informed, and culturally responsive, care for children involved with the child welfare system.
Learning objectives:
Participants will be able to understand the importance of providing a developmentally appropriate narrative for children regarding life events or when life changes occur.
Participants will be able to identify who should provide the narratives and when they should occur based on the needs of the child.
Participants will be able to identify roadblocks to providing narratives as well as to identify how to address these roadblocks.
